What is the Vantage SIPP Contribution Form?
The Vantage SIPP Contribution Form is a crucial document for contributing to your Self-Invested Personal Pension (SIPP) in the UK. This form allows individuals to make a single personal contribution by cheque or set up a monthly direct debit, facilitating a straightforward contribution process. The form includes essential fillable fields such as your full name, postcode, and date of birth to ensure accurate processing.

Who is eligible to use the Vantage SIPP Contribution Form?
Individuals who are UK residents and have a SIPP account with Hargreaves Lansdown can use this form to make contributions.
What are the deadlines for submitting the form?
There are no strict deadlines, but it is advisable to submit your contributions before the end of the financial year to maximize tax benefits.
How can I submit the Vantage SIPP Contribution Form?
You can submit the form by downloading it after completion and emailing it to Hargreaves Lansdown, or by mailing a printed copy of the form.
What supporting documents do I need to include?
Typically, you only need the completed SIPP Contribution Form. Additional documents may be required if you are altering existing agreements, such as proof of identification.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all personal information is accurate, particularly your bank details and signature. Double-check that you have selected the correct investment options.
How long does it take for contributions to be processed?
Processing times can vary, but contributions are generally reflected in your SIPP account within a few working days after submission.
Can I use this form for both single and monthly contributions?
Yes, the Vantage SIPP Contribution Form can be used to make either a single contribution by cheque or to establish or increase monthly direct debit contributions.
